Texas Justices Question Med Mal Suit Nix Over 'Technicality'
By Jess Krochtengel ( October 11, 2017, 6:08 PM EDT) -- Two Texas Supreme Court justices said during oral argument Wednesday they are bothered that a "technicality" in the form of an allegedly defective expert report could wipe out a medical malpractice claim with "obvious merit" brought by a patient who was blinded during cataract surgery....
